Estate and tenant clearance skips in Kempton Park.
Clearance work for letting agents, executors and body corporates has a different shape to a normal household job: the date is set by someone else, nobody knows exactly what is inside until the door opens, and a property often has to be handed over broom-clean. That means the sensible approach is a bin sized generously, booked for a firm delivery slot, with a plan for the items that cannot legally go in it.
What goes in
- Furniture, appliances and household contents
- Carpets, curtains and bedding
- Boxes, paperwork and general clutter
- Garden and garage contents
- Broken fittings and abandoned goods
What does not
- Fridges, freezers and air-conditioners with refrigerant gas
- Televisions, computers and other e-waste
- Paint, solvents, pool chemicals and garden poisons
- Firearms, ammunition and anything requiring a legal chain of custody
- Documents that must be securely destroyed rather than dumped
Sizing
Sizing a skip for estate / tenant clear-out work
Over-size rather than under-size. A clearance that runs out of skip on the day usually costs more in a second callout and a missed handover than the larger bin would have. Where you genuinely cannot see inside first, ask the operator what a swap costs so you have a fallback.
Builders skip
about 6–9 m³
Site rubble on an active build, multi-room renovation debris, larger household clearances and bulky garden loads.
Watch: Needs real truck access — length to reverse in and headroom to tip the bin off the back. Measure your gate before you book.
Maxi skip
about 10–12 m³
Whole-house clearances, shopfitting and office strip-outs, and light-but-bulky construction waste.
Watch: A poor choice for dense rubble — you will hit the weight allowance at a fraction of the volume and pay an overload charge for the privilege.
What to tell the operator
- 01The hard deadline for handover or transfer
- 02Whether anyone has been inside and can describe the contents
- 03Whether the property is furnished, part-furnished or hoarded
- 04Who holds keys and who will be on site to accept the delivery
- 05Whether documents need secure destruction rather than disposal
- 06Whether appliances and electronics need a separate collection

Estate and tenant clearance skips in Kempton Park: questions
- Can I clear a property without the owner present?
- That depends on your legal standing, not on the skip. Executors, appointed agents and sheriffs act under authority; a landlord acting alone on a tenant's goods generally does not. Get the authority right before you book anything — a skip operator will not adjudicate it.
- How quickly can a skip get to a Kempton Park property?
- That is the operator's call and depends on their fleet and where they are working that week — this site will not promise you a delivery time on their behalf. What helps is giving a firm address, an access description and a realistic window when you request the quote.
- What happens to items that still have value?
- Separate them before the skip is loaded. Once furniture and appliances are in a bin under other waste they are effectively gone. If the estate needs items valued or auctioned, that has to happen first.
- Is personal information a concern?
- Yes. Clearance properties are full of documents, and simply skipping bank statements and ID copies creates a real exposure. Bag paperwork separately and use a shredding or secure-destruction service for anything sensitive.
